Alturas Inlet Campground


Area Status: Open

Alturas Inlet Campground, located on beautiful Alturas lake, is composed of 28 campsites including 8 double-sites. This site accepts reservations which can be made at www.recreation.gov or by calling (877)444-6777. A day use beach and picnic area is located within walking distance of the campground on the north side of the lake. There is excellent canoeing, kayaking and fishing available on Alturas lake as well as Perkins Lake. Spend sunny summer days fishing for trout, sailing, motorized boating, swimming, and picnicking by the lake. No personal watercraft are allowed on Alturas lake or Pettit lake.

Restrictions: Pets must be on a leash. All occupancy (includes developed/dispersed camping, boats, boat trailers, travel trailers, tents, etc): Occupancy limit is 10 days in a 30 day period within a 30 mile radius for all of SNRA. Campers must occupy the site the first night and cannot go more than 24 hours thereafter without occupying the site. Motorized vehicles and bicycles are not allowed in any of the designated wilderness areas.

General Information

Directions:

From Stanley, go south 21 miles on ID 75, then west about 4 miles on Forest Road 205.
